Olise hits stunning hat-trick as France beat Northern Ireland

Michael Olise scored his first senior international hat-trick to send France into the World Cup in style, as Didier Deschamps’ side beat Northern Ireland 3-1 in Lille.

It was a special occasion at the ground, with the home fans giving a warm send-off to Deschamps ahead of his expected departure after this summer’s tournament. The France manager named a strong side for the occasion.

France dominated from the off but had to wait until just before half-time to break the deadlock, when a deflected Ousmane Dembélé shot fell kindly for Olise to tap home. Northern Ireland had largely kept Les Bleus at bay up to that point, and Patrick Kelly had even threatened on the break in the first half.

Four minutes after the restart, Olise doubled France’s lead with a sharp finish after the ball dropped to him inside the box.

Northern Ireland pulled one back when Shea Charles won the ball and squared for Kelly to slot home, only the second goal his country have ever scored against France. That seemed to unsettle the hosts briefly, but Olise put the game to bed with a superb curling effort into the far corner from the edge of the box to complete his hat-trick.

It was not all good news for France, however, with Jules Koundé picking up a knock and being withdrawn at half-time, a potential concern just eight days before their World Cup opener against Senegal.

The result extends France’s unbeaten run against Northern Ireland to seven games, as Deschamps’ side now turn their full attention to winning a third World Cup crown.
